when the lights go out tonight, when the last plane has lifted off from the ground, the city once again goes to its sleep, heavy breathing lights are blown out from empty frames the candles of the city die figures walked on, without a purpose, without a life beneath the dark grey sky, i sit alone in silence
a grey bird stood on a grey tree the tree stood there, as it has always done, a tiny spot - the only spot thousands of miles spread out toward grey infinitude occasionally the rustle of tired leaves would break the delicate perfection of the scene a breath of autumnal wind walks through this world
the bird whispers sadness to the passing wind the wind sings in accordance - in its pouring tears raindrops touch the cold ground as the kisses of sadness that holds the memory of yesterday's tragedy up and down, waves of emotion swell up as ripples on a still lake a pair of blind eyes stare into its own mind, the bird sings
only november, when snowflakes cover up the sorrows of another year everything is in white, everything is dying beautifully in fairytale-like peace and silence as i open my bleeding eyes, i can suddenly see sadly, you drive alone in a dead world still playing that song i wrote for you 1000 years ago watching you in silence, watching you from the other side three words hang motionlessly from the tree where they committed their suicide
S I L E N C E
the bird stops singing, but the wind carries on crying too many tears, too many nights of hollow breathing all of the unspoken sorrows springs up from the ground flooding the scene, dissolving everything the world swirls without warning the grey throws itself into the surging ocean the tree crumbles into the ground the ground melts into the sky sky turns from grey to colorless...
as the ocean becalms everything is transparent as the ocean becalms all fades...
as lights go out tonight, as the last plane lifts off from the ground, the story awaits, unfolds
